Violation Summary
IMPTRHACCP
The food appears to have been prepared, packed or held under insanitary conditions, or may have become injurious to health, due to the failure of the importer to provide verification of compliance pursuant to 21 CFR 123.12(d).
INSANITARY
The article is subject to refusal of admission pursuant to Section 801(a)(3) in that it appears to have been prepared, packed, or held under insanitary conditions whereby it may have become contaminated with filth, or whereby it may have been rendered injurious to health.
SALMONELLA
The article is subject to refusal of admission pursuant to Section 801(a)(3) in that it appears to contain Salmonella, a poisonous and deleterious substance which may render it injurious to health.

What is an FEI number?
FEI stands for Firm Establishment Identifier. It's a unique number assigned by the FDA to identify establishments that manufacture, process, pack, or hold food, drugs, medical devices, or other FDA-regulated products. Pesquera Don Luis, S.A. De C.V.'s FEI number is 3002671670.
